Various innovations in hair loss treatments are affecting the expansion of the alopecia market. Recent breakthroughs in biotechnology and regenerative medicine are providing some hope for restoring lost hair, and they include platelet-rich plasma (PRP) therapy and stem cell-based treatments. Pharmaceutical companies are on a fast track to develop topical applications, oral medications, and injectable therapies that have a common goal: to stimulate hair growth while preventing further hair loss. Gene therapy and biomaterials are being investigated for developing customized treatment plans of high effectiveness. In addition, artificial intelligence integration linked with digital health technologies has transformed patient care; it enables scalp analysis with precision and recommends individualized treatment. With such advances coupled with increased funding for research, the alopecia market is evolving and bringing with it novel solutions to meet the increased demand.
